Sikuekue:
Hey Fam, please help out. I've just been invited to Accra for interview to verify my employment details. Asked to come with employment letter, payslips and account statement showing salary inflows. Who has been invited previously? What was the experience like? Will these documents be retained for verification? What do I expect? Please help a sister.

First of all, congrats because you are almost there.
Did you not include these things in the first place?
Though I have not been in your shoes but I advise you to go with the following items:

1. Payslips
2. copy of ID card
3. Excel document showing net pay on the payslip reconciled to date remittance was made in your salary account .
4. Company registration document and tax clearance if you can get it.
5. Pension statement showing contribution made in payslip
6. If your company is a contractor, also go with a copy of the purchase order or contract from customers.
7. If possible, also obtain letter of introduction from your employer.
8. Your HMO ID card which should show your employer's name


With these documents (or most of them), you should be able to prove your employment beyond doubt.

Blessed are they whose POF is in just one place. You shall not roam around Lagos anyhow cry

Thats how I thought it would be a quick dash in and out of bank and MMF and pension office oh. Feeling like I could walk in and walk out with what I need. I was soooo wrong.

So as information for others...... Stanbic Pension would process your request for statement and ref letter in 24hrs (you won't pay anything but you would have to give them a letter of instruction/request).... See Pg 0 for format
Stanbic MMF would process in 48hrs and you'd need to pay N2,625 to their account and send them evidence of payment + address you want the ref addressed to and other details).... they do not require a request/instruction letter.
ARM MMF would process in 24hrs and you'd need to pay N2,000 to their account and send them evidence of payment + address you want the ref addressed to and other details).... they also do not require a request/instruction letter.
GTBank would give you your statement there and then but will not give you a tailored reference letter. The generic one they have is N525. You can decide to add a "letter of non-indebtedness" and "signature confirmation letter" and each is also N525..... though I didn't see the need for it.

The GT lady however mentioned that if you want a tailored ref letter, then you contact your account officer (you can get those details when you log in to your internet banking profile)... your account officer would then be the one to obtain approval and prepare a tailored letter for you if they choose..... Sample tailored letter is also on Pg 0.

sthillz:
I can't seem to understand this tie breaking rule. Does it mean profiles from December 12 to present get ITA?

CRS cutoff for this draw is 441

If your CRS is above 441 = ITA

IF your CRS is 441:
Created profile on or before December 12, 2017 = ITA
Created profile after December 12, 2017 = NO ITA
